Session javaee状态完整bean不工作

Session javaee状态完整bean不工作,session,java-ee-7,wildfly-8,stateful-session-bean,Session,Java Ee 7,Wildfly 8,Stateful Session Bean,我已经定义了一个@Stateful@StatefulTimeout(value=2,unit=TimeUnit.HOURS)restbean,这样它就可以保存一个私有MyContext用户上下文(基本上是一个列表,其中包含传递给restbean的所有以前的值) 我已经在openshift上的wildfly 8.1容器中启动了我的webapp 不幸的是,我的豆子不能正常工作 似乎每次调用都会重新创建bean,就好像容器无法将两个调用关联到同一个会话一样。客户端上没有cookie或会话id参数这一事

我已经定义了一个
@Stateful@StatefulTimeout(value=2,unit=TimeUnit.HOURS)
restbean,这样它就可以保存一个
私有MyContext用户上下文
(基本上是一个
列表
,其中包含传递给restbean的所有以前的值)

我已经在openshift上的wildfly 8.1容器中启动了我的webapp

不幸的是,我的豆子不能正常工作

似乎每次调用都会重新创建bean,就好像容器无法将两个调用关联到同一个会话一样。客户端上没有cookie或会话id参数这一事实似乎证实了这一点

我的应用程序/配置中可能缺少什么?为什么wildfly不能自动创建用户会话



编辑:示例代码:

查看您的代码示例,您似乎缺少了一个
@SessionScoped
注释,如中所述。

PS。如果您没有任何线索,因为wildfly应该自动处理它,只需“+1”此注释或留下您自己的注释,以便我相信这不是wildfly的正常行为,代码示例可能会有所帮助。您是否在其他服务器(如Glassfish)上测试过该bean/示例?@AlexanderLanger我上传了一个示例:如果您还有5分钟的时间,谢谢您的回答;)我已经更新了我的样本并发布了一个新问题:对不起,不知道另一个(从未使用过)谢谢!你能看一下真是太好了